Ordinals
beta
Sat 690680337603075
decimal
138136.337603075
degree
0°138136′1048″337603075‴
percentile
32.889539922039226%
name
iynsfnhyhgo
cycle
0
epoch
0
period
68
block
138136
offset
337603075
timestamp
2011-07-26 13:44:57 UTC
rarity
common
prev
next